Decoding the Language of the Bouquet of Flowers Emoji

The most obvious use of the bouquet of flowers emoji is to represent congratulations. Did your friend ace an exam? Did a colleague land a big deal? A virtual bouquet says “Well done!” in a cheerful and visually appealing way. Its a simple way to show your support and excitement for their achievement.

Need to express gratitude? A bouquet of flowers emoji can soften a thank you message. It adds a touch of sincerity and appreciation. Use it when someone goes the extra mile for you, or when you simply want to acknowledge their kindness with something more than just words.

This lovely emoji is perfect for celebrating special occasions! Think birthdays, anniversaries, or even just a regular Tuesday that needs a little brightening. The bouquet of flowers emoji can add a festive touch to any message, helping to spread joy and positive vibes all around.

The bouquet of flowers emoji is a wonderful way to show someone you’re thinking of them. If a friend is feeling down or going through a tough time, sending this emoji can be a simple way to offer comfort and support. Its a reminder that you care and are there for them.

Want to add a touch of romance to your messages? The bouquet of flowers emoji is a sweet and subtle way to do it. Whether you’re flirting with a crush or sending love to your partner, this emoji can help you express your affection in a lighthearted and charming way.

In professional settings, a bouquet of flowers emoji can be used to acknowledge team successes or to celebrate milestones. It can inject a bit of positivity into workplace communication, and acknowledge great effort from your team. Use it to show appreciation and boost morale in the office!
